Reviewers say 'You are Wanted' receives mixed feedback. Positive reviews commend engaging plot twists, strong performances by Matthias Schweighöfer, and good cinematography. The suspenseful storytelling and relatable characters are praised. Conversely, negative reviews point to poor dubbing, slow pacing, and lack of originality. Many find the plot confusing and the acting subpar. Some criticize the portrayal of government institutions and unrealistic scenarios. Despite these issues, several recommend watching the original German version with subtitles.

- CuriosidadesYou Are Wanted (2017) is a German drama series directed and produced by and starring Matthias Schweighöfer, first released on 17 March 2017 by Amazon Video, the first foreign-language Amazon Original Series to be released globally. The series was written and created by Hanno Hackfort, Bob Konrad and Richard Kropf.
